    Comment Comment: VALIDATED REFSEQ: This record has undergone validation or preliminary review. The reference sequence was derived from AK143476.1, AK164186.1 and AK165759.1. Transcript Variant: This variant (2) has multiple differences, one of which results in the use of a downstream start codon, compared to variant 1. The resulting protein (isoform 2) is shorter when it is compared to isoform 1. ##Evidence-Data-START## Transcript exon combination :: AK165759.1, AK164186.1 [ECO:0000332] RNAseq introns :: single sample supports all introns SAMN01164131 [ECO:0000348] ##Evidence-Data-END##

    Comment Comment: VALIDATED REFSEQ: This record has undergone validation or preliminary review. The reference sequence was derived from AC128702.4 and AC166052.5. On Jan 13, 2018 this sequence version replaced XM_006511908.3. Transcript Variant: This variant (3) lacks a 5' exon which results in the use of a downstream start codon, compared to variant 1. The resulting protein (isoform 3) is shorter when it is compared to isoform 1. ##Evidence-Data-START## Transcript exon combination :: AK170197.1 [ECO:0000332] RNAseq introns :: single sample supports all introns SAMN00849374, SAMN00849380 [ECO:0000348] ##Evidence-Data-END##
